About 119 Burlington Court
119 Burlington Court is a mid-terrace house in Newcastle Upon Tyne (NE2 2HR). It has a recorded floor area of 78 m² (around 840 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1967-1975 and council tax band C. At 78 m² this is the 11th smallest of 14 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 46–106 m². The building's EPC ratings span E to C, with this unit at the bottom. On EPC score it ranks last in the building (39 versus a best of 74). The latest certificate (September 2018) shows an E (score 39),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The rating has held steady at E across 3 certificates since October 2008. Between certificates, lighting went from Poor to Very Good. The recommended improvements would push it to D (score 59).
